Ebay Sr Product Manager-Risk Platform AI/ML 
United States, California, San Jose

What you will accomplish:

  • Lead product strategy and execution of Decision Platform; develop and champion product strategy to empower business to easily implement, execute, and carry out decision strategies across all user flows

  • Build and implement a compelling roadmap supporting our Decision platform to enable risk and compliance management

  • Drive epic and sprint level prioritization, product backlog grooming and be the process owner of business RTB requests

  • Be customer centric and make sure product asks and feedback are addressed with proper actions

  • Work very closely with Engineering/Business partners and senior product managers to contribute to building a solid risk foundation/platform product backlog

  • Synthesize your product ideas/designs with cross-functional teams and/or with other Risk counterparts such as Identity, Policy, Policy Operations, Rule writers and Decision Sciences

  • May need to collaborate and work closely with eBay global engineering, product and business stakeholders such as teams in EU and China

  • Strong and positive interpersonal skills to lead the product conversations especially when the problem is ambiguous

What you will bring:

  • Bachelor’s degree, MS/MBA preferred

  • Minimum of 6+ years of Product Management experience with expertise in one or more of following areas - Risk, Payments or e-Commerce

  • 2+ years experience in core platform product management. Knowledge of Decision Platforms for Fraud Detection/Risk Management and/or Building Machine Learning Infrastructure is a huge plus

  • Ability to effectively prioritize and complete tasks in a dynamic environment using a data-driven and analytical approach

  • Experience with product development lifecycle, process flows and working in an agile environment

  • Standout colleague with empathy for our customers (both internal and external) and desire to understand their needs, wants and concerns

  • Self-starter with the ability to present/assert/pursue independent ideas and drive them to execution with minimal mentorship; think strategically and execute tactically

  • Proficiency in basic data analysis using tool such as Excel, SQL, Tableau

The pay range for this position at commencement of employment in California, Washington, or New York is expected in the range below.

$135,200 - $205,700
